i know my g/fs taurus has an audio processor in the trunk (mach system) and her stock setup sounds pretty decent... but i've always wondered if thats really doing much of anything.


and whats this "time alignment"?

Frequencies contained in a complex musical waveform arrive at the listener in correct phase, with no delay between the woofer, midrange, and tweeter.
A good test for that is a square wave.

Basically what it does is adjust the timing of each speaker so they arrive to your ears at the same time or very close to.

Theres a noticeable difference when I used that feature of the Pioneer 880PRS.

The only huge downside is it sounds like SHIT for anyone not in the drivers seat...
